- Austin (9/5): Very spacious, pretty convenient location, pretty great deal overall - Huge space for a reasonable price!
Pretty cheap for a place pretty close to the Shin-Ōsaka station.
It was very nice to have the two toilet rooms and the one shower room all separate from each other.
Very conveniently walking distance from the Higashi-Yodogawa station! A pretty long walk from Awaji or Shin-Ōsaka, though it's a fun walk through the market street to Awaji, at least the first one or two times.
The place seems old, but pretty well maintained. I thought the decorations were lovely. It felt like living in an old-fashioned Japanese home.
Everything was rather acceptably clean.
We liked the laundromat over by the Lawson more than the Dumbo coin laundry that came recommended by the property. There were no curtains or blinds in the second-floor bedroom; with windows on three sides and early summer sunrises, it was hard not to wake up quite early.
The staircase connecting the two floors is very steep, with very narrow steps. There are plenty of sturdy handrails, but it can still be scary. If you're going to that upstairs bathroom in the middle of the night, you're passing right next to a precipitous drop.
The downstairs bedroom is deafening during heavy rain; those of us who slept there during the rainy night were kept awake for much of the night by it.
It was stressful to have such a small key to carry around, with the threat of such a large fine if the key was lost. In retrospect, maybe we should have just kept it in the lockbox.
